The amount of nitrogen in an organic substance can be determined by an analytical method called the Kjeldahl method, in which all the nitrogen in the organic substance is converted to ammonia. The ammonia, which is a weak basek can be neutralized wiric acid, as described by the equation NH3(aq) +HCl(aq) arrow NH4Cl(aq) if 22.0 mL of 0.150 M HCl(aq) is needed to neutralize allthe NH3(g) from a 2.25 g sample of organic material, calculate the mass percentage of nitrogen in the sample.
